Overview
ABM Integrated Solutions is looking for a solutions‑focused Level 2 IT Services Technician to join our team in Calgary, AB. This hands‑on, client‑facing role requires a high degree of technical skill, clear communication, and a strong commitment to delivering reliable service. You will travel regularly to customer sites within Calgary, work independently, and tackle a wide variety of infrastructure and systems tasks.
PrimaryResponsibilities
- Resolve escalated support tickets from Level 1 Technicians involving servers, networking, and cloud applications.
- Perform routine maintenance on client environments, including patching, backups, and end‑point management.
- Provide on‑site support, diagnostics, and troubleshooting for customers whose issues cannot be resolved remotely.
- Deliver professional, customer‑focused service while working independently at customer sites.
- Collaborate with Level 3 team members on client infrastructure improvements and technical projects.
- Maintain and update client technical documentation.
- Assist with the deployment and configuration of workstations, networking gear, and cloud tools.
- Communicate clearly with clients and internal stakeholders regarding issue resolution.
- Participate in on‑call rotation and after‑hours assistance as required.
- 3 to 5 years of technical support experience in an MSP environment.
- Strong understanding of Windows Server, Active Directory, modern networking concepts, and cloud services (M365, Azure).
- Experience using Linux (Debian), Proxmox, and Proxmox clustering considered a big asset.
- Ability to independently troubleshoot complex technical issues and manage competing priorities.
- Experience participating as a technical resource in infrastructure upgrades, system migrations, or deployment projects.
- Excellent customer service, communication, and documentation skills.
- A valid class 5 Canadian driver’s licence and willingness to travel as required to customer sites.
